BAD BAD service and poor attitude - visa

I need a re-entry visa for my Italian passport as I am traveling abroad. I was told to go to the first floor. There was no signage except counter numbers and no enquiry desk. I was bounced around from counter to counter by various officials for an hour. They clearly had no clue what a re-entry visa was. Finally I was directed to counter '31' where there had previously been nobody. The lady behind the counter then told me I needed a 'ticket' before I could even queue anywhere. I looked around and asked her where I could get a ticket. With a huge attitude she told me I needed to get it on the 2nd floor. 2nd floor? An asylum would have made better sense that this place.By now I was late for work and I need to re-schedule another session
